Contracts Manager
Role: Contracts Manager - Shopping Centre
Salary: £55-60k
Job Status: Permanent / Full Time
Location: Nottingham, East Midlands
Vacancy Reference: VR/05419
Role Description:
As a self-motivated individual you will work to ensure the full delivery of all Customer Contracts within contractual guidelines and to manage effectively the Supervisory and engineering team, through target driven performance requirements, structured review meetings and to work closely with the Account Manager to provide overall efficiencies and profitability with no aged debt and a strong management and understanding of WIP. You will foster strong customer relationships through existing and new business opportunities and work and be guided by your direct line manager to provide support as and when required. To provide operational, financial and commercial management of the shopping centre and to develop further business opportunities and revenue within the portfolio. You will build on customer relationships and develop your team to provide outstanding customer service.
Main Duties:
Ensure all Company and Client Health and Safety Policies and procedures are adhered to, referring conflicts to the Account Manager where necessary.
Update asset lists, schedules and instruction sets on the computerised maintenance management system.
Ensure that supervisors plan the labour, schedule the tasks and ensure the effective completion of the PPM & Reactive works both direct & sub-contractors.
Ensure all reactive calls are logged and closed on the CMMS, utilising supervisors and administration staff as required.
Work to agreed quality systems, ensuring preventative and remedial actions are taken where necessary as laid down in the quality manual.
Provide technical support to team
Contribute to the appraisal of staff and suppliers
Identify cost effective good working practice on site, including spares holding, bulk replacements, refurbishments, alternative suppliers and maintenance regimes
Ensure best purchasing practise using the companies nominated suppliers.
Ensure that Risk Assessments, COSHH records and safe methods of work records are held on site.
Ensure that records are maintained in compliance with local and national legislation.
Support Account Manager in all internal and external audits that are undertaken.
Ensure that the work schedules are regularly reviewed to ensure best value for money and efficient delivery of services to our client requirements.
Ensure that the correct staff and efficiency levels are maintained on site
Ensure that administration procedures and records are maintained in line with company policy and appropriate industry associations e.g. ISO 9001.
